THE CEO CHALLENGE is an exciting and successful Junior Achievement High School program focused on developing entrepreneurial thinkers and building leadership skills. Students will set goals, manage time and resources in a real life learning “Shark Tank” like event. The CEO Challenge is an interactive learning experience designed to engage
and inspire students who enjoy risk taking and want to be challenged in unique and fun ways.

CEO Challenge is a career prep approved, tuition free activity. It can be woven into the regular school day or be an after school project. Schools may have multiple teams of
3-6 students; each team receives a $100 stipend to cover team presentation supplies. Teachers receive $400.00.

Spark:
- A one day Youth Entrepreneurial Summit
- Open to all high school students 10th—12th grade
- Through interactive activities, and networking with other students and local business mentors students are involved in entrepreneurial thinking and high energy team building
activities.
- At the end of Spark students get more information about the next steps to Ignite and Launch.

Ignite:
- Students form teams at their schools; each team develops a business idea to present at Launch in March.
- Student driven: Interactive learning modules give students needed skills to create/develop/launch their business concept
- Teachers guide their teams through the JA provided learning modules 1-2 hrs a week
- Local Subject Matter experts provide "real life" knowledge and advice
